At TE, you will unleash your potential working with people from diverse backgrounds and industries to create a safer, sustainable, and more connected world. Job Overview

The customer service role involves demand planning, order management, customer-facing interactions, geographical interface management, and addressing diverse customer needs and operational challenges. It requires analytical, communication, and problem-solving skills, along with a customer-centric mindset to deliver exceptional service, drive customer satisfaction, and foster loyalty in ASEAN, with an annual revenue of approximately $180 million. Job Responsibilities

Customers Management Handle incoming calls and emails from assigned accounts regarding sales inquiries, order status, lead times, incoterms, and stock availability. Proactively communicate with customers to ensure understanding and resolve order-related issues. Analyze Demand Forecast/ Revenue & Inventory Control Analyze demand forecasts for assigned accounts, review and control inventory to meet business targets. Conduct demand planning, upload forecasts, manage replenishment orders, and billing for consignment customers. Generate forecast and LE reports for Monthly Sales Revenue. Review actual demand against forecasts to prevent excess inventory or stockouts. Customer Documentation & File Management File all sales transactions and related documents, including purchase orders, shipping documents, and customer inquiries. Shipment Management Prepare and process shipments per customer requests. Coordinate with Planning/Logistics to ensure on-time delivery. Oversee drop-shipment orders and follow up on shipment status. Handle credit releases and coordinate with Account Managers and customers on shipment holds. Payment Management Follow up on disputes and invoice discrepancies, issue credit/debit notes as needed.
